Contributions of Cancer Treatment, Comorbidities, and Obesity to Aging-related Disease Risks among Non-Hodgkin’s Lymphoma Survivors

Abstract
Purpose: . It is unknown whether cancer treatment or modifiable risk factors contribute more to the burden of long-term disease risks among B-cell non-Hodgkin’s lymphoma (B-NHL) survivors. Methods: . B-NHL survivors were identified in the Utah Cancer Registry from 1997 to 2015. Population attributable fractions (PAF) were calculated to assess the role of clinical and lifestyle factors for 6 cardiovascular, pulmonary, and renal diseases. Results: . Cancer treatment contributed to 11% of heart and pulmonary conditions and 14.1% of chronic kidney disease. Charlson Comorbidity Index (CCI) at baseline contributed to all six diseases with a range of 9.9% of heart disease to 26.5% of chronic kidney disease. High BMI at baseline contributed to 18.4% of congestive heart failure and 7.9% of pneumonia, while smoking contributed to 4.8% of COPD risk. Conclusion: . Cancer treatment contributed more to heart disease, COPD, and chronic kidney disease among B-NHL survivors. High BMI at baseline contributed more to congestive heart failure and pneumonia than cancer treatment, whereas smoking at baseline was not a major contributor in this B-NHL survivor cohort. Baseline comorbidities consistently demonstrated high attributable risks for these diseases , demonstrating a strong association between preexisting comorbidities and aging-related disease risks.
